Frequently asked questions about alternative provision mentor pay in Lurgan

How much does an alternative provision mentor earn in Lurgan?

The average salary for an alternative provision mentor in Lurgan is £23,750 per year, typically ranging from £20,900 per year to £28,500 per year depending on experience, phase and school type.

Is Lurgan a well-paid area for alternative provision mentors?

Lurgan tends to sit around 5% below the UK average for alternative provision mentors. Regional demand, cost of living and school funding all play a part.
